课程简介
植物生态生理学是一门力求阐明各种生态现象生理机制的实验科学,是植物生态学的一个分支。着重研究控制植物生长、生殖、生存、丰度和地理分布等的生态问题与植物生长发育受植物本身及其物理、化学和生物环境之间的互作影响。
教学内容
本课程教学内容以Hans Lambers等编写的《Plant Physiological Ecology》(第二版)及其第一版的中译本(张国平等译《植物生理生态学》,浙江大学出版社)为基础。课堂讲授的内容主要包括绪论、光合作物、呼吸作用、能量平衡、同化物的运输、生长与物质分配、水分关系、营养生态、生命周期(环境影响与适应性)等。
